London's LibDem Euro-MP Baroness Sarah Ludford has added her support to a joint letter with Greek MEP Alexandros Alavanos and other MEPs to Tony Blair, highlighting the case for the return of the Parthenon ('Elgin') Marbles to Athens in time for the 2004 Olympics.
Sarah Ludford is a supporter of the campaign group Parthenon 2004 and sees 2004 as a perfect opportunity for the UK to give a commitment to reunite the Marbles.
"The Marbles need to be displayed in their proper context, only then will they be able to be fully appreciated.
"Restoring the unity of the monument would be a forward looking, internationalist act for world heritage and it would be a disgrace if the Government misses this perfect opportunity."

A high percentage of the British public opinion - 81% in a recent poll, but also 90% of people employed at the Museums of Britain according to an opinion poll - are in favour of the demand for restitution of the Parthenon Marbles to Athens in the course of 2004.
According to a written declaration of the European Parliament of 28.01.1999 (O.J. C128/07.05.1999) in connection with the return of the Parthenon Marbles, "the return of the Parthenon Marbles to Greece would be a key move in promoting Europe's common cultural heritage".
We call upon your government to examine positively the request of Greece for the return of the Marbles and in this way to contribute to the restoration of the integrity of the Acropolis's Monument.
